If you have diabetes, high blood pressure, heart disease, and varicose veins, consuming Yashtimadhu (Licorice/Mulethi) regularly is generally not advisable without medical supervision, because it may increase blood pressure and cause fluid retention in some people. ••Understanding Irattimadhuram (Yashtimadhu / Licorice) Irattimadhuram (commonly known as ••Yashtimadhu in Sanskrit or Mulethi in Hindi; Latin: Glycyrrhiza glabra) is a highly revered herb in Ayurveda, known for its Madhura Rasa (sweet taste) and Sheeta Virya (cooling potency). It is exceptionally beneficial for respiratory health, hyperacidity, and skin disorders.
•However, given your specific complex medical history—comprising Blood Sugar (Diabetes), Blood Pressure (Hypertension), Heart Problems, and Varicose Veins—consuming Irattimadhuram requires extreme caution and is generally not recommended. Why Irattimadhuram is Contraindicated for Your Conditions •While it is a natural herb, its active chemical component, glycyrrhizin, exerts systemic effects on the body that can severely aggravate your current health conditions: 1. Blood Pressure & Heart Problems (Critical Risk) ••Sodium Retention & Potassium Depletion: Glycyrrhizin causes the body to retain sodium and excrete potassium. This fluid retention directly leads to an increase in blood pressure (hypertension). ••Cardiac Strain: The resulting high blood pressure and low potassium levels (hypokalemia) place a dangerous load on the heart. It can trigger or worsen cardiac arrhythmias (irregular heartbeats), fluid overload, and exacerbate pre-existing heart failure. 2. Varicose Veins ••Increased Venous Pressure: Varicose veins are caused by weakened valves in the veins struggling to return blood to the heart. The fluid retention caused by Irattimadhuram increases overall blood volume and venous pressure, which can lead to increased swelling (Shotha), heaviness, and pain in your legs. 3. Blood Sugar ••Metabolic Impact: While some isolated studies look at its antioxidants, classical consumption of the raw root or its sweet formulations can interfere with metabolic harmony. More importantly, managing blood sugar becomes incredibly difficult if your blood pressure and cardiovascular functions are unstable. Holistic Ayurvedic Perspective & Safe Alternatives ••In Ayurveda, managing a multi-morphic condition like yours requires balancing Vata and Pitta without disturbing Kapha, and strictly avoiding herbs that cause fluid accumulation (Kleda). ••Instead of Irattimadhuram, Ayurveda utilizes alternative herbs that safely target your conditions simultaneously without raising blood pressure: ••Arjuna (Terminalia arjuna) Hridya (Cardioprotective) Strengthens cardiac muscles, helps regulate blood pressure, and improves vascular tone. ••Punarnava (Boerhavia diffusa) Mootrala (Diuretic) Reduces fluid retention and swelling in the legs (beneficial for varicose veins) without depleting potassium, while supporting blood pressure management. ••Amalaki (Phyllanthus emblica) Rasayana / Pramehahara Rich in vitamin C, helps manage blood sugar levels, strengthens blood vessels, and provides potent cardiovascular antioxidant support. ••Guduchi (Tinospora cordifolia) Tridosha Shamaka Helps regulate metabolic profiles and blood sugar while offering general cellular protection.
